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/asp.net-core/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android语音检测_Android_Microphone_Voice Detection - Fatal编程技术网

Android语音检测

Android语音检测,android,microphone,voice-detection,Android,Microphone,Voice Detection,我正在开发一个Android应用程序(目前仅适用于三星Galaxy S4),在该应用程序中,我需要持续监控麦克风发出的声音,以检测声音,以及可能有多少人在说话(我不想识别人们在说什么,只想检测有人在说话)。我怎么做?唯一的方法是通过MediaRecord GetMaxAmplication()?但是我怎么能理解有多少人在说话呢?谢谢您可以通过声音获取通话中的人数,而不是获取有多少人在通话。很抱歉,可能我没有正确解释问题,我不想检测通话中的人数,但我想检测有多少人和我在同一个房间。从录音中识别扬声

我正在开发一个Android应用程序(目前仅适用于三星Galaxy S4),在该应用程序中,我需要持续监控麦克风发出的声音,以检测声音,以及可能有多少人在说话(我不想识别人们在说什么,只想检测有人在说话)。我怎么做?唯一的方法是通过MediaRecord GetMaxAmplication()?但是我怎么能理解有多少人在说话呢?谢谢

您可以通过声音获取通话中的人数,而不是获取有多少人在通话。很抱歉,可能我没有正确解释问题,我不想检测通话中的人数,但我想检测有多少人和我在同一个房间。从录音中识别扬声器的数量可能对人来说都很困难,所以我怀疑你是否能找到一个简单的解决方案。试着寻找研究论文,看看其他人是否以及如何完成这项任务。